Hiking around Niederfinow is characterized by a blend of natural landscapes and historical engineering. The region features the Finow Canal, Germany's oldest navigable artificial waterway, offering paths alongside its locks and natural areas. It is also situated near the extensive Schorfheide-Chorin Biosphere Reserve, known for its glacial-formed landscape of deep pine woods and clear lakes. The terrain generally includes forested areas and waterways, with gentle elevation changes.

In the information center, you will receive all important information for your stay at the two ship lifts. If you are interested in a visit or guided tour, corresponding tickets can be purchased at the counter. The special exhibition on the new ship lift is also located in the information center and can be visited free of charge.

Between March and October, scheduled trips are offered several times a day with the ships "Luise" and "Freiherr von Münchhausen II". The journey begins here at the landing stage in the lower harbor of the Old Ship Lift, near the entrance to the over 400-year-old Finow Canal. After the lift has been completed, the ship turns around in the upper harbor area and returns to the starting point after the downward journey. The main ticket office of SHW Fahrgastschifffahrt can be found in the tourist information office in the power house. Source and online tickets: https://www.schifffahrt-niederfinow.de/

The mill was expanded by the Cistercians and developed into a large workshop, which served as a machine hall and, in addition to milling grain, also facilitated other production processes such as hammering, stamping, and oil-making. The buildings were constructed of granite ashlars, which are still clearly visible today. The mill building was probably originally four stories high and designed as a four-wheel mill with four openings for waterwheel shafts.

Regular cultural events take place, including the popular "Chorin Music Summer," special and art exhibitions, and guided tours. A permanent exhibition, opened in April 2017, provides information about the life and work of the monks, as well as historical discovery and monument preservation efforts. A free app called "Chorin Monastery 3D - At the Time of the Cistercians" allows for a digital exploration of the complex.

Absolutely. The Finow Canal, Germany's oldest navigable artificial waterway, offers picturesque hiking opportunities. A well-maintained path known as the "Treidelweg" runs alongside the canal, allowing you to observe its historic locks and enjoy the tranquil waters. A great option is the easy Lieper Lock – Bridge at Lieper Lock loop from Niederoderbruch, which follows the canal landscape.

Niederfinow is accessible by public transport, primarily by regional train and bus services. You can reach the area via Eberswalde, which has good train connections. From there, local buses can take you to various starting points for hikes. It's advisable to check current schedules for specific routes.
